On January 31, 2024, just after midnight, two youths were arrested in the 1600 block of Burrows Avenue for an armed robbery.
Officers from the North District, the K9 Unit and TST located the youths after fleeing from the reported robbery in the Gilbert/Burrows area. A male and female couple reported standing at a bus stop when they were confronted by suspects armed with a handgun. They demanded their groceries, and the male victim was shot in the face with a C02-powered firearm.
The male victim in his 40s was transported to hospital in stable condition and treated, while the female in her 40s was not physically injured.
A 14-year-old and a 17-year-old male from Winnipeg are both facing the following charges:
- Robbery X 2
- Using Imitation Firearm in Commission of Offence
- Point Firearm
- Possess Weapon for Dangerous Purpose
- Causing Bodily Harm with Intent – Air Gun or Pistol
They both remain in police custody at this time.
